What companies run services between Rosslare Strand, Ireland and Kildare, Ireland?

You can take a train from Rosslare Strand to Kildare via Tara Street, Abbey Street, Heuston, and Dublin Heuston in around 4h 3m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Doogans Warren to Kildare via Wexford O'Hanrahan Station, Redmond Square, and Hanover Bus Park in around 4h 48m.
